Solothurn Monthly Rainfall & Precipitation
This page shows both the average monthly rainfall and the number of rainy days in Solothurn, Canton of Solothurn, Switzerland. Long-term data from 1990 to 2020 was used to calculate these averages. Now, let's explore all the details to give you a full picture.
Solothurn has a notably wet climate with abundant precipitation, recording 1392 mm (55 in) of rain/snowfall per year.
Monthly Precipitation Levels
The average number of days each month with precipitation (> 0.2 mm (0.01 in))
While rainfall varies throughout the year, each season offers its own charm. May brings wetter days averaging 148 mm (5.8 in) of precipitation, spread over 18 rainy days.
In contrast, February experiences a drier climate, with about 88 mm (3.5 in) of snow/rainfall spread across 14 snowy/rainy days.
May, the wettest month, has a maximum daytime temperature of 19°C (66°F). The city receives 195 hours of sunshine in this period. Precipitation amounts are measured using specific gauges installed at weather stations, collecting both rain and snow and any other type of precipitation. Rainfall is measured directly in millimeters, while that from snow and ice is obtained by melting it. Automated systems often incorporate heaters to make this easier.
Information from these stations is transmitted via Wi-Fi, satellite, GPS, or telephone connections to central monitoring networks. This information is immediately updated and integrated into weather models and forecasts.
